Ted Nugent says he is insulted by the cancellation of his planned concert at an Army post over his comments about President Obama.
Commanders at the Fort Knox post in Kentucky nixed Nugent's segment of a June concert after the rocker and conservative activist said at a recent National Rifle Association meeting that he would be dead or in jail by this time next year if Obama is re-elected.
Nugent told The Associated Press his words were not intended as a threat against the president.
Nugent said he had received messages of support from troops and noted that the Secret Service had met with him and closed its case about the remarks earlier this month.
